Comparison review

The Pantech Flex has a general score of 52.7, which is a bit better than the Motorola RAZR D1's 48 global score. Pantech Flex's design is notably thinner but somewhat heavier than Motorola RAZR D1. Both phones in this comparison review use Android operating system, but Pantech Flex has the newer 4.1.2 version and Motorola RAZR D1 has Android 4.1 version, providing a couple additional features and performance enhancements.

Pantech Flex has a better processing power than Motorola RAZR D1, because it has a GPU and 1 more cores. Pantech Flex has a brighter screen than Motorola RAZR D1, because it has a larger screen, a way higher resolution of 960 x 540px and a lot better pixels count per inch of display. The Pantech Flex has a lot bigger memory to install applications and games than Motorola RAZR D1, and although they both have a SD memory card expansion slot that allows up to 32 GB, the Pantech Flex also has 8 GB internal storage capacity.

Pantech Flex's battery lifetime is just as good as the Motorola RAZR D1 one, although the Pantech Flex also has a 1830mAh battery capacity. Pantech Flex shoots greater photographs and videos than Motorola RAZR D1, because it has a way higher video definition and a back camera with a way better 8 mega pixels resolution.

In addition to being the best phone in this comparison, the Pantech Flex is also a lot cheaper.
